Output 30dd3947b5fc3bd04ed506048783685137344e302c5c3b78b3ffd44c2897a839:3

value
42487131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27a7acf00d292562a6eb9f2919dee655236c9b95 OP_EQUAL
address
MBWqTDG4ceY5ceQXAjHsdmZesNSpYHst4p
transaction
30dd3947b5fc3bd04ed506048783685137344e302c5c3b78b3ffd44c2897a839
spent
true